Satellite Cartographies

The rise of remote sensing has ushered in an era of fantastic possibilities for geographic understanding, most notably through the creation of satellite mappings. These complex visual tools utilize data captured across a wide spectrum of radiant energy to reveal imperceptible variations in surface features – things that would be unlikely to discern through conventional visual observation. This allows for refined recognition of vegetation health, mineral Psychogeography makeup, and even buried groundwater structures, providing invaluable insights for a range of academic disciplines.
